This allows gravity to keep blood flowing to … WebPhysical triggers. Getting too hot or being in a crowded, poorly ventilated setting are common causes of fainting. Sometimes just standing for a very long time or getting up too fast after sitting or lying down can cause someone to faint. Emotional stress. WebTreatments for vasovagal syncope include: Consuming a high-salt diet. Stopping medicines that lower blood pressure, like diuretics. Taking medicines to increase sodium, fluid levels … WebRestoring adequate blood flow to the brain is key to preventing vasovagal syncope (fainting); this can be achieved by laying down with legs lifted, sitting down with your head between your knees, or muscle tensing.
